(The Sayre Headlight, Sayre, Beckham Co, Ok, 17 Sep 1931) Illness Fatal to Early County Settler. William A. Brodderick (sic) dies of Diabetis Tuesday morning at Elk City Hospital. William A. Brodderick, 58, Sayre, died in an Elk City hospital Tuesday morning after being seriously ill for two weeks. He had been in ill health for some time suffering from diabetis. Mr. Brodderick was one of the oldest settlers in this county. He resided in Carter before coming to Sayre and was well known in the county and Western Oklahoma. Prior to his illness, Mrs. Brodderick operated the Ezirest tourist park two miles north of this city. He is survived by one son James Brodderick of Sayre, one daughter Mrs. Laura Widle of Carter, two brothers J. T. (should be G. T.) Brodderick, Carter, and J. M. Brodderick, Sayre, and one sister, Mrs. Alice Swetman, Sayre. Funeral services were held at the Carter cemetery Wednesday afternoon with Rev. Carr of Sayre officiating. Interment was made in Carter cemetery. Litteral and Moore were in charge of the arrangements.
